Loomio
Sun 26 Jul 2020 6:02AM

Help installing or if possible is there any automated script for installing like the one GasparI made for ubuntu 16?

J joesab Public Seen by 60

Hi there, I would apreciate some help. basically I know some frontend webdev but I'm not good at building dependencies or stuff

so couldn't make the regular install work, neither the docker install and the only video I found in youtube is installing in Mac

so is there any automatic installation script? like the one GasparI  had made? or any other way to install it ? or more detail list of the commands needed for ubuntu?

RG

Robert Guthrie Mon 27 Jul 2020 9:46PM

try

docker-compose run app rake db:schema:load
J

joesab Mon 27 Jul 2020 11:12PM

@Rob Guthrie I'm really thankful for all your time spend in this software, and time giving support to the community.

Unfortunately the Docker deployment version still doesn't work for me. I will take a Docker and databases course this following week.

I will take a look at the development deployment as it to me seems more promising than relying on Docker I have used docker before but this is the first time it doesn't work at first try (somehow is not as easy as I thought LOL)

so clearly I'm missing something in my install

but for now I think I will leave it since even trying with my own purchased domain and everything still nothing

I don´t want to take more of your time, you guys have been generous enough with your time.
with all my heart thanks

J

joesab Mon 27 Jul 2020 11:14PM

maybe after I re-take my old linux-bash courses i may write an script as Gaspar Did for the old ubuntu 14

if, so I would happily share it, you guys already work hard

I hope to one day give back something useful to the community

have a wonderful day

and big thanks appreciate your help

G

GasparI Thu 3 Sep 2020 7:30AM

Hi,

I believe that Loomio needs the simplest "next-next-finish" installer possible to become really successful worldwide.

I have managed to follow through install instructions (impossible without advanced Linux knowledge) but I also failed to install it next to Apache, which is a circumstance on the target server I must accommodate.

Please see this new post: https://www.loomio.org/d/wxE3sCDj/loomio-docker-install-next-to-apache

@joesab How important this is for you? If you could contribute, let's say 50 €, then we would need less than 10 people to finance this effort.

We could also launch a crowdfunding campaign to do so.
@Rob Guthrie - I'd love to hear your thoughts on this.

RG

Robert Guthrie Thu 3 Sep 2020 8:59AM

I don't quite understand how to achieve a next-next-finish workflow, and support you to run it in a custom configuration (ie: with Apache).

I don't understand how I can help. If you follow the instructions I've provided, it'll work, but it's up to you to configure it differently to that.

G

GasparI Thu 3 Sep 2020 9:25AM

Let's say Apache is installed and used, it's a common scenario.

If you follow the instructions, they won't work in their current form. As I mentioned not even I was able to find out yet how to avoid conflicts with 80/443 standard ports.

The concept is the same I did with 14.04 and 16.04 - make the installation as easy as running a single command in such case.

G

GasparI Thu 3 Sep 2020 9:36AM

@Rob Guthrie Btw, I wouldn't bother you with server config issues for special cases. You already do so much with development for which I am grateful.

Would you, and the team, feel okay if such special efforts are funded via community/crowdfunding?

RG

Robert Guthrie Thu 3 Sep 2020 7:00PM

Thanks for your support and enthusiasm, @GasparI.

To me, having an existing server doing existing stuff is a special use case, and you're going to need to have a level of linux expertise to manage that responsibility. I've supported maybe 50 people to install Loomio and the vast majority of them were installing onto a new VPS with their own domain name and email server.

Working out how to load balance traffic to multiple apps, or diagnose a problem, is something the sysadmin will always have to take responsibility for, no matter what apps they want to run. Any one click installs you find for other apps will not support installing onto an existing server with http ports in use.

To be clear, I don't think this is appropriate for crowdfunding because I don't think the problem is clear. Either seek support with configuring your server with multiple virtual hosts (a reasonable thing to do), or ask for help developing a one (ish) click install, but they are separate things.

Finally, we don't have any more time, and cannot prioritize the work should you run a crowdfunding campaign. It would be great if you could find people with the skills to do what you want and fund them, so that we have more Loomio experts in the world.

However I acknowledge there may be demand for better support to self host Loomio, and maybe there is an opportunity for that to generate revenue for Loomio. We could offer one click loomio installs with selected VPS providers (starting with digitalocean, maybe) and provide DNS, Email and other configuration out of the box, along with a choice of your-choice.loomio.net domain names.

J

joesab Mon 7 Sep 2020 10:26PM

@T thanks I would love to give it a try, but the link you provided isn't working, could you send the direct link pls?

yeap no worries I think i can manage the port/Virtualhost. your help is highly appreciated

J

joesab Mon 7 Sep 2020 10:36PM

@GasparI I totally agreed with you buddy, In order for Loomio to be successful worldwide it needs "next-next-finish" installer (Monkey/dummy proof installer). I'm sure it super hard to do for the developers

sadly right now due to COVID-19 I don't have as many resources as I had

(company where I work is working at 20% so not as much income as it use to)

But as soon as I can if you are still Crowdfunding I'm totally in.

Load More